I have a 2015 scout with heated front seats.

Does anyone know whether the wiring is present to enable retrofit of a heated front screen?

If it is, what other than a replacement screen, heater control panel and coding would be required?

 

Thanks

The wiring isn’t present and it would be well over £1000 to do this. Nobody sells a kit for it so you would have to research on ETKA and ErWin to find out exactly what you need.

Sorry to bear the bad news but the cheapest you can get a heated screen is £800 for the glass, then ADAS calibration on top plus the wiring, it’s not worth it. A great extra, but not a viable retrofit sadly.

  • Author

I’d hoped because the car has heated seats that make up part of the “winter pack” which is the only way to spec the heated screen the wiring could be there. I hadn’t realised the glass was as expensive so definitely not a viable option which is what I expected.

Well, the BCM will likely have the pins available for it, but there isn’t a spare plug already in the car waiting sadly and yes, the glass is the real killer cost.
